1. (1) These Rules, which may be cited as the Rules of the Superior Courts (Appearances) 2026, shall come into operation on the 8th day of May 2026. | ||||||||||||||||||||
(2) These Rules shall be construed together with the Rules of the Superior Courts. | ||||||||||||||||||||
(3) The Rules of the Superior Courts as amended by these Rules may be cited as the Rules of the Superior Courts 1986 to 2026. | ||||||||||||||||||||
2. These Rules shall apply in proceedings commenced both before and from the date on which these Rules come into operation. | ||||||||||||||||||||

(v) by the substitution for sub-rule (1) of rule 2 of Order 12 of the following sub-rule: | ||||||||||||||||||||
“(1) Save as otherwise provided for in rule 2(3), an appearance to any plenary summons, summary summons or originating notice of motion in which a respondent is named shall be entered within ten days after the service of the summons or motion, exclusive of the day of service, unless the Court shall otherwise order.”; | ||||||||||||||||||||
(vi) by the substitution for sub-rule (2A) of rule 2 of Order 12 of the following sub-rules: | ||||||||||||||||||||
“(2A) A named respondent in proceedings commenced by originating notice of motion, and to whom notice of such motion has been given, and any other party joined to such proceedings by order of the Court or named in the title, who intends to appear in the proceedings shall enter an appearance to such notice of motion in the Form No. 9 in Appendix A, Part II, within ten days after service of the notice of motion or such other time as may be fixed by the Court. Where a respondent or other party is given notice of such motion after the date first fixed for the hearing of the notice of motion, he or she shall enter an appearance thereto within the time fixed by the Court for that purpose. | ||||||||||||||||||||
(2B) A respondent or other party in proceedings commenced by originating notice of motion shall not, without the leave of the Court, be entitled to be heard in such proceedings unless he or she has entered an appearance or otherwise has a statutory right to be so heard, provided that the Court may hear such person on foot of an undertaking to enter an appearance. | ||||||||||||||||||||
(2C) Sub-rule (2A) shall apply mutatis mutandis in inter partes proceedings commenced by any other originating document not otherwise referred to in this Order. | ||||||||||||||||||||
(2D) Subject to sub-rule (2A), the provisions of rules 1, 3 to 8 inclusive, 10 to 13 inclusive, and 26, shall, as far as applicable and with any necessary modifications, apply to an appearance entered in accordance with sub-rule (2A), or sub-rule (2A) as applied by sub-rule (2C). | ||||||||||||||||||||
(2E) For the avoidance of doubt, the entry of an appearance does not confer on a person a right to be heard that such person would not otherwise enjoy.”; | ||||||||||||||||||||
(vii) by the deletion from Order 12 of rule 4; | ||||||||||||||||||||
(viii) by the insertion immediately following rule 18 of Order 12 of the following rule: | ||||||||||||||||||||
“18A. (1) An appearance may be entered with the plaintiff’s written consent to extend the time, given under Order 122, rule 8, but an appearance may not be entered, except with the leave of the Court, if the plaintiff has obtained judgment in default of appearance. | ||||||||||||||||||||
(2) Where an appearance is entered outside the time permitted for that purpose, with or without the plaintiff’s consent, judgment in default of appearance shall not subsequently be given unless the Court, on the application of the plaintiff on notice, sets aside the appearance. | ||||||||||||||||||||
(3) Where an appearance is entered outside the time permitted for that purpose, without the plaintiff’s consent, the plaintiff shall be taken to have waived any objection to late entry of the appearance by a subsequent written consent to extend the time, given under Order 122, rule 8, or by taking a further step in the action. ”; | ||||||||||||||||||||
(ix) by the insertion immediately following rule 29 of Order 12 of the following rules: | ||||||||||||||||||||
“30. An appearance may be expressed as unconditional, or as conditional for the purpose of objecting to the jurisdiction of the Court. Where a conditional appearance has been entered and the Court dismisses the objection, the party who has entered a conditional appearance may enter an unconditional appearance within ten days from the date of the order of the Court, without prejudice to the right to appeal the order dismissing the objection. | ||||||||||||||||||||
31. Notwithstanding any other provision of these Rules, a person who contests the validity of the service on him or her of any originating or other document may be heard on the issue of the validity or otherwise of such service although he or she has not entered an appearance.”; | ||||||||||||||||||||
(x) by the substitution for rule 3 of Order 13 of the following rule: | ||||||||||||||||||||
“3. Where any respondent in proceedings commenced by originating notice of motion fails to enter an appearance to such notice of motion (or, having failed to enter an appearance, has not been heard by leave of the Court in accordance with sub-rule (2B) of rule 2 of Order 12), the Court may, on the hearing of the motion, if satisfied as to the service of notice of the motion on that respondent, grant such of the reliefs sought in the notice of motion against such respondent as seem just and proper.”; | ||||||||||||||||||||

(xii) by the substitution for sub-rule (4) of rule 22 of Order 84 of the following sub-rule: | ||||||||||||||||||||
“(4) Any respondent or notice party who intends to appear on an application for judicial review by way of motion on notice or an application on notice for leave to seek judicial review: | ||||||||||||||||||||
(a) shall enter an appearance in accordance with Order 12, rule 2(2A) within ten days of being put on notice of the proceedings or such other time as may be fixed by the Court, and | ||||||||||||||||||||
(b) shall, if that respondent or notice party intends to oppose the application for judicial review following the grant of leave, within three weeks of service of the notice on the respondent concerned or such other period as the Court may direct, file in the Central Office and serve copies on all other parties of: | ||||||||||||||||||||
(i) a statement setting out the grounds for such opposition, and the name and registered place of business of the respondent’s or notice party’s solicitor (if any), and | ||||||||||||||||||||
(ii) if any facts are relied on in that statement, an affidavit, in Form No. 14 in Appendix T, verifying such facts. | ||||||||||||||||||||
For the avoidance of doubt, the provisions of Order 12, rule 2(2E) apply to entry of an appearance in accordance with this rule.”; and | ||||||||||||||||||||

EXPLANATORY NOTE | ||||||||||||||||||||
(This note is not part of the Instrument and does not purport to be a legal interpretation.) | ||||||||||||||||||||
These rules amend a number of Orders, in particular Orders 4, 12 and 84 by changing the time for filing an appearance in the High Court to 10 days and extending the requirement to file an appearance to respondents and other parties joined to the proceedings or named in the title who wish to be heard by the Court in proceedings commenced by originating notice of motion or brought by way of judicial review. They also provide for the filing of an appearance for the purpose of contesting jurisdiction. |
